JOB OBJECTIVES:
Based in Lyon and reporting to the Finance Department of HI, you will join the management control team of the federal network and national associations on a permanent contract.
As Financial Controller, you will be responsible for the financial management, budget oversight, and internal control of your area of responsibility, in compliance with local standards and the financial framework of the Handicap International network. You will provide operational support to the Management, the teams within your area of responsibility, and the governance bodies, while also contributing to cross-functional projects for the federal network.
Working closely with the Director, you will participate in strengthening the governance and financial planning of the network.
In order to achieve this goal:
Accounting and Treasury Management
You contribute to the monthly and annual accounting closings related to the shared services of the HI Federation.
You monitor cash flow and anticipate financing needs.
You coordinate statutory audits and maintain the relationship with the auditors.
Compliance and internal control
You guarantee compliance with legal, tax and regulatory obligations (annual accounts, VAT).
You contribute to the continuous improvement of internal control and risk management.
Budgetary management and financial control
You develop, monitor and revise the budget.
You set up and analyze financial indicators (KPIs), monitor variances and identify risks.
You prepare the operating accounts, financial reporting and materials for the General Meeting.
You provide support and guidance to budget managers.
Institutional funding
You support the financial management of institutional contracts: budgets, amendments, reports, cash flow monitoring and audits.
You act as the interface with the Programmes, Institutional Funding teams… and the HI Federation.
Cross-cutting missions within the HI network
You will be responsible for the financial management of other national associations or shared services within the network (federal directorates, payroll management, etc.), as needed.
You carry out cross-functional financial analyses, ad hoc studies or contribute to structuring projects (improvement of processes, deployment of tools in national associations, at the federation or on programs).

WORKPLACE ACCESSIBILITY:
The premises are easily accessible by public transport (bus, metro). Car park and bicycle parking are also available. Within the building, access ramps and elevators ensure smooth circulation. All workstations are located in an open-plan area, but quiet booths are available on each floor for those who wish to work in peace and quiet. The workspace is very bright.
A disability liaison officer is available to answer any questions and assist you with the necessary procedures. The position can be adapted to your needs.
